  • Page 52.3 Display of parts working time 2.3.1 Display Push soft-key [ACT TM], screens for parts working time are displayed. Color of working time display changes to red in case working time is over 90% of the limit time set in advance. And working time is displayed by reverse character in case working tim
  • Page 62.3.3External signal (Output signals to PMC in case of over limit time) If working time is over the limit time for any item, warning signal (F226#0) is output to PMC. And if the following items are over the limit time, the signal (F226 #1 to #7) is output corresponding to the each item. Please use t

  • Page 122.8 Operation of leak check It is possible to set parameters for leak check and confirm leak check result by leak check screen. Pushing soft-key [leak] makes displaying leak check screen. Switching off gas control start signal (G222#6) after setting parameters for leak check causes starting leak che
  • Page 13Laser gas pressure 1 to 4 (Diagnose No.954 to 957) read during leak check are displayed. The data are only displayed and cannot be reset or operated. The data are displayed by Torr and kilo-Pascal (kPa). [Leak check screen] [ LEAK CHECK ] LEAK CHECK (1:ON 0:OFF) [*] LEAK JUDGEMENT TIME [*****]SEC ST
